浙江省嘉兴市届高三信息技术上学期期中试题docWord文档格式.docx
《浙江省嘉兴市届高三信息技术上学期期中试题docWord文档格式.docx》由会员分享,可在线阅读,更多相关《浙江省嘉兴市届高三信息技术上学期期中试题docWord文档格式.docx(15页珍藏版)》请在冰点文库上搜索。
6.使用GoldWave软件打开某音频文件,选中其中一段音频后的部分界面如图所示。
下列说法正确的是()
A.该音频文件10秒的存储容量约为431KB
B.当前状态下执行“删除”命令后,该音频右声道第20秒开始将出现静音
C.当前状态下执行“剪裁”命令后,整个音频只剩下当前选中的部分
D.当前状态下执行“插入静音”4秒命令后,直接保存文件容量保持不变
7.某算法的部分流程图如图所示。
执行这部分流程,循环结束时i的值是()
A.13
B.11
C.9
D.7
8.随机产生一个二位正奇数的VB表达式是()
A.Int(Rnd*99)+1
B.Int(Rnd*88)+11
C.2*Int(Rnd*45+5)+1
D.2*Int(Rnd*45+5)-1
9.有如下VB程序段:
a
(1)="
231"
:
a
(2)="
34"
a(3)="
23"
a(4)="
234"
a(5)="
123"
Fori=1To2
Forj=1To5-i
Ifa(j)>
a(j+1)Thent=a(j):
a(j)=a(j+1):
a(j+1)=t
Nextj
Text1.text=a(j)
Nexti
执行该程序段后,文本框Text1显示的内容为()
A.34B.123
C.231D.234
10.下面VB程序段运行后,文本框Text1和Label1显示的内容分别是()
PrivateSubCommand1_Click()
DimyAsLong
Text1.Text="
"
y=f(3)
Label1.Caption=Str(y)
EndSub
Functionf(nAsInteger)AsLong
Text1.Text=Text1.Text+Str(n)
Ifn<
=1Then
f=1
Else
f=f(n-1)+2
EndIf
EndFunction
A.321和5B.123和5
C.5和321D.6和321
11.有如下程序段:
Dima(1To5)AsInteger
t=0
Fori=1To5
a(i)=Int(Rnd*30+10)
t=t+a(i)\10
Nexti
Forj=1Tot\3
IfjMod2=1Thena(j)=a(j)+1Elsea(j)=a(j)-1
Nextj
运行程序后,数组a各个元素的值,不可能的是()
A.40,10,32,11,17B.34,9,33,33,31
C.12,13,14,9,10D.31,32,33,9,21
12.有如下程序段:
s="
defghiabc"
key=Text1.Text
i=1:
j=Len(s)
DoWhilei<
=j
m=(i+j)\2
c=Mid(s,m,1)
Ifc=keyThenExitDo
IfMid(s,i,1)<
cThen
Ifkey>
=Mid(s,i,1)Andkey<
cThenj=m-1Elsei=m+1
Else
cAndkey<
=Mid(s,j,1)Theni=m+1Elsej=m-1
EndIf
ans=ans+Str(m)
Loop
运行程序后,若在文本框Text1中输入字符"
b"
,则变量ans的值是()
A.5B.578C.53D.57
二、非选择题(本大题共4小题,其中第13小题4分,第14小题8分,第15小题7分,第16小题7分,共26分。
13.小张收集了2019年3-6月份分地区工业用电量(亿千瓦时)数据,并使用Excel软件进行数据处理,如第13题图a所示。
13题图a
请回答下列问题:
(1)计算6月份环比数据,可以先复制E6单元格,以公式粘贴方式粘贴到I3单元格,然后通过I3单元格对区域I4:
I13自动填充,则I3单元格中的公式是▲。
(2)根据13题图a中的数据制作图表如13题图b所示,创建该图表的数据区域是▲。
13题图从b
(3)Excel可以按行排序,选择区域B2:
I13,按照图c所示的方式进行排序。
排序完成后,图b显示的图表_▲_(填:
会/不会)改变,B3单元格显示的内容可能为___▲___(单选,填字母:
A.#REF!
B./C.-3.3D.#VALUE!
)。
13题c图
14.小王使用Flash软件制作主题为“水墨山水”的多媒体作品。
请回答下列问题:
(1)在制作动画前,小王进行了相应的分析和规划。
下列属于创作需求分析的是▲(多选,填字母:
A.该作品要求使用Photoshop、Flash软件制作/B.结构类型为演示型/C.明确该作品的主题思想/D.制订脚本大纲/E.了解社会需求。
注:
全部选对的得2分,选对但不全的得1分,不选或有选错的得0分)
(2)如图所示,为了使“小岛”图层中的内容从第1帧就出现并持续到第50帧,下列操作方法中正确的有▲填字母:
A.复制第15帧至第1帧/B.删除第1帧至第14帧/C.对第1帧执行清除关键帧/D.将第15帧移至第1帧。
全部选对的得2分,选对但不全的得1分,不选或有选错的得0分)。
(3)如图所示,“船”图层实现了船先从位置(600,600)移动至位置(400,300),移动至位置(100,300),最后移动至位置(-100,100)的效果,那么“船”图层第15至第50帧的动画类型是▲(单选,填字母:
A.逐帧动画/B.动画补间/C.形状补间)。
整个动画船的移动轨迹是▲(单选,填字母:
(4)测试影片时,单击当前场景中的“简介”按钮,关闭动画,并在浏览器中显示位于同一文件夹下“jianjie.htm”文件的内容,则该按钮的动作脚本为on(release){__▲____}。
15.数组a存储降序排列的m个数据,数组b中存储的是升序排列的n个数据,且两个数组中存储的数据为区间[1,20]范围内的不重复的随机整数。
现将两个数组的数据合并到c数组中,使c数组的数据为左右交替上升,如下表所示:
当窗体Form1加载时,自动产生a、b数组的数据,并分别显示在列表框List1与List2
中,单击合并按钮Command1后,在c数组中保存按规则合并后的a、b数组的数据,并显示在列表框List3中。
程序截图如下所示:
实现该功能的VB程序如下:
Constm=5
Constn=6
Dima(1Tom)AsInteger
Dimb(1Ton)AsInteger
Dimc(1Tom+n)AsInteger
‘窗体加载时,生成数组a、b中的数据,并按要求排序后显示在列表框中,代码略
DimpaAsInteger,pbAsInteger,pcAsInteger,sAsInteger,flagAsBoolean
pa=m:
pb=1:
pc=1
flag=True
DoWhile①
Ifa(pa)<
b(pb)Then
s=a(pa)
pa=pa-1
s=b(pb)
pb=pb+1
c(pc)=s
IfflagThen
pc=m+n-pc+1
pc=m+n–pc
.②
‘处理a、b数组中剩余数据,并在列表框List3中输出数组c,代码略
(1)窗体加载的事件处理过程名为__________。
(填字母:
A.Form1_Click/B.Form_Click/
C.Form1_Load/D.Form_load)
(2)加框处代码有错,请改正。
(3)在划线处填入合适的代码。
16.小蓝设计了一个数字字符串的简单加密解密小程序,该程序的加密规则是计算连续升序子串的长度,将该长度字符插入到相应子串后面。
例如:
输入2350123456783,先将字符串拆成三段,分别是235,012345678,3要求每一段必须严格有序,如果无法实现连续升序,则单独作为一个拆分。
原字符串
235
012345678
3
连续升序字符数
3
9
1
密文
在文本框Text1中输入原文,单击“加密”按钮,可在文本框Text2中输出密文。
在文本框Text2中输入密文,单击“解密”按钮,可在文本框Text3中输出原文。
(1)程序运行时,在文本框Text2中输入“1233012345678910”,则在Text3中显示的内容为。
(2)实现上述功能的VB代码段如下,请在划线处填上合适代码。
PrivateSubCommand1_Click()'
加密过程
Dima(1To100)AsString
Dims1,s2AsString:
DimtmpAsInteger
tmp=1:
s1=Text1.Text
Fori=1ToLen(s1)
a(i)=Mid(s1,i,1)
s2=a
(1)
Fori=2ToLen(s1)
If①Then
s2=s2+a(i):
tmp=tmp+1
Else
s2=s2+LTrim(Str(tmp))'
LTrim()函数用以移除左边的符号位空字符
s2=s2+a(i)
②
s2=s2+LTrim(Str(tmp)):
Text2.Text=s2
PrivateSubCommand2_Click()'
解密过程
Dimb(0To100)AsString
DimkAsString,tAsInteger,nAsInteger
DimsAsString,s3AsString,jAsInteger
s=Text2.Text:
n=Len(s)
Fori=1Ton
b(i)=Mid(s,i,1)
t=n-1:
k=Val(b(n))
DoWhilet>
0
Ifk<
>
0Then
Forj=1Tok
③
t=t-1
k=Val(b(t))
t=t-1
k=10
Text3.Text=s3
2019学年第一学期期中考试
高三技术参考答案
第一部分:
信息技术(共50分)
一、选择题(本大题共12小题,每小题2分,共24分,每小题列出的四个备选项中只有一个是符合题目要求的,不选、错选、多选均不得分。
题号
2
4
5
6
7
8
10
11
12
选项
B
C
A
D
二、非选择题(第13小题4分,第14小题8分,第15小题7分,第16小题7分,共26分)
13.(4分)
(1)=(H3-F3)/F3*1001分
(2)A2:
A13,H2:
H131分
(3)会、A2分
14.(8分)
(1)ABC2分
(2)ACD2分
(3)B、C2分
(4)fscommand("
quit"
);
getURL("
jianjie.htm"
2分
15.共7分
(1)D(1分)
(2)m+n–pc+2或其它等同答案(2分)
(3)①pa>
=1Andpb<
=n(2分)
②flag=Notflag(2分)
16.共7分
(1)1230123456789(1分)
(2)①a(i)>
a(i-1)(2分)
②tmp=1(2分)
s3=b(t)+s3(或等价表达式)(2分)